Cajun Cafe’s Bourbon Chicken –
Cajun food is wonderfully spicy without being too hot. This chicken makes up a saucy and savory dish that really hits the spot. Bourbon gives this dish a unique flavor, serve with white rice to make sure you sop all of the extra sauce.
Yield: 4 servings.
1 lb. Chicken leg or thigh meat Cut in bite size chunks
4 oz. Soy sauce
1/2 C. Brown sugar
1/2 tsp. Garlic powder
1 tsp. Powdered ginger
2 Tbsp. Dried minced onion
1/2 C. Jim Beam Bourbon Whiskey
2 Tbsp. White wine
Mix all the marinade ingredients and pour over chicken pieces in a bowl.
Cover and refrigerate (stirring often) for several hours (best overnight). Bake chicken at 350 for one hour in a single layer, basting every 10 minutes. Remove chicken. Scrape pan juices with all the brown bits into a frying pan. Heat, and add 2 tablespoons white wine. Stir and add chicken. Cook for 1 minute and serve.
